Abstract

The utility model relates to the field of crushers, in particular to a multifunctional crusher which comprises a box body assembly, a door plate assembly, an upper cover plate assembly and a core assembly, wherein the box body assembly is arranged on the ground, the door plate assembly is hinged on the box body assembly, the upper cover plate assembly is fixedly connected to the upper end of the box body assembly, the core assembly is fixedly connected in the cavity of the box body assembly, the opening size of a feeding port is reduced by designing different feeding ports, the multifunctional crusher has the function of a special material port, the safety of an operator is protected, and the fed articles can be classified and crushed by designing different feeding ports, so that the problem that the phenomenon of blocking is easy to occur when the conventional crusher feeds materials at the same time and exceeds the shearing limit of a cutter is solved.

Background
The crusher is a machine for crushing thrown materials by utilizing an internal cutter, the cutter shaft is driven to rotate relatively by the relative rotation of the cutter shaft, so that thrown articles are sheared and shredded, different crushers have different product types according to purposes, such as paper shredders, crushers and the like, the principle is different, the conventional crusher generally has no pertinence, if the thrown articles of different types exceed the shearing limit of the cutter, the phenomenon of clamping is easy to occur, the crusher needs to be opened for cleaning, time and danger are wasted, in addition, the conventional crusher has a larger opening, does not have a special purpose function, and accordingly, sundries fall off or danger is caused.

The machine core assembly 4 comprises a cutter box 4a, a machine core receiving port 4b, a motor 4c, a double-row small chain wheel 4d, a driving cutter shaft 4e, a driven cutter shaft 4f, a double-row large chain wheel 4g, a driving gear 4h and a driven gear 4j, wherein the cutter box 4a is fixedly connected to the upper end of a blanking port 1h, the lower end of the machine core receiving port 4b is fixedly connected to the upper end of the cutter box 4a, the upper end of the machine core receiving port 4b is fixedly connected with the lower end of a feeding reducing port 3d2, the motor 4c is fixedly connected to one side of the cutter box 4a, the double-row small chain wheel 4d is fixedly connected to an output shaft of the motor 4c, the driving cutter shaft 4e and the driven cutter shaft 4f are respectively and rotatably connected to the cutter box 4a, the double-row large chain wheel 4g and the driving gear 4h are both fixedly connected to one end of the driving cutter shaft 4e, the double-row large chain wheel 4g and the driving gear 4h coaxially rotate, the driven gear 4j is fixedly connected to one end of the driven gear 4f, and the drive gear 4h and the driven gear 4j are engaged. The machine core assembly 4 is used for smashing the articles put into the device, the motor 4c rotates to drive the double-row small chain wheel 4d to rotate, the double-row small chain wheel 4d is connected with the double-row large chain wheel 4g through a chain, further the double-row large chain wheel 4g and the driving gear 4h rotate, the driving gear 4h is meshed with the driven gear 4j, therefore, the driving cutter shaft 4e and the driven cutter shaft 4f rotate relatively, the cutter in the cutter box 4a is further driven to rotate relatively to cut and smash the articles falling down through the machine core material receiving opening 4b, and the cut and smashed crushed materials fall down from the bottom of the cutter box 4 a.
